Another day, another gear start edger... this one has me a bit miffed though!

Just when i thought i was getting the hang of these repairs, i get a spanner thrown in the works!

What i have is a gear start tiltacut. Initially i have recognized an induction air leak (the mower did not respond to throttle action, would over rev and cut out in 20 or so secs from overheating).

I thought it was the carby but for good measure i decided to check the top seal (which was fine). After replacing the carby i have throttle response and a good rev range (just like in my other one which is flawless).

Now here is the part that miffs me, i run the edger at start/full speed and it will run, though when i begin using it to edge the kerbs, the edger seems to cut out, at which point i must pull on the starer 2/3 times to restart the mower! The mower is not running out of petrol as there isnt that typical short over rev cycles before it cuts out, its just that it seems to stop for no apparent reason. Sometimes i can hear the edger struggling so i correct the edger so it tries to correct its revs but no luck, it just dies out.

Would anyone have any idea what might be going on here?

How much angle.


How do you do your gutters??? Pehraps a picture???

Mine just does its thing and makes sparks and stuff.


If yours is cutting out it could only be spark or mixture. One would think a rich mixture because as you said its not revving up. So you are tipping it away from the primer face then???

could be rich,it would explain why it puffs a bit when it restarts.

In any case it has stopped stopping so it seems fine!

I guess i should stop being lazy and actually change the cutting height when doing the kerb as having the edger on a 30 degree angle is not too smart :P

I have also expressed my grief with the engineering oversight of placing the fuel filter in the reservoir on the opposite side of the tilt so that if youre running low on fuel and you 'tilt to cut' you essentially starve your mower.
